Positioned on the edge of the village of Corsley, this attractive and well-presented family home enjoys a peaceful rural setting with far-reaching views across open countryside towards Cley Hill. Surrounded by some of the area’s most beautiful landscapes and within easy reach of Warminster, Frome and the historic city of Bath, the property offers the best of village living with excellent connectivity beyond.
A porch opens into a small entrance hallway, creating a welcoming introduction to the house and setting the tone for the sense of space and balance that follows. To the left, a generous sitting room stretches across the depth of the house, filled with natural light from windows to both the front and rear. A wood-burning stove sits at its heart, making this a warm and inviting space for evenings in and relaxed family living. To the right of the hallway is a second large reception room, currently used as a dining and family room. This flexible space works equally well for entertaining or everyday life, with room for a large dining table alongside a more informal seating area. It flows naturally through to the rear of the house, connecting the ground floor beautifully. The kitchen sits to the rear, enjoying views out over the garden and countryside beyond, and is supported by a separate utility room that provides practical storage and direct access to the garden, ideal for busy family life.
Upstairs, a good-sized landing creates a sense of openness and light. There are three well-proportioned bedrooms, all benefiting from large windows and open countryside views, giving each room a bright and airy feel. The main bedroom enjoys the added benefit of an en suite shower room, while the remaining bedrooms are served by a modern family bathroom.
Outside, the gardens are a particular feature. The front garden is enclosed and thoughtfully planted, creating an attractive approach to the house. To the rear, the garden enjoys a high degree of privacy and a sunny aspect, backing directly onto open fields. Laid mainly to lawn with established planting and several seating areas, it is a wonderful space to relax, entertain and enjoy the ever-changing rural outlook.
Agent's Note: This property shares a septic tank which will require upgrading, the cost of that repair has been factored into the asking price.
The property is very well located in this popular village which has two public houses, sports field, tennis courts, reading room and village church. The village lies between Frome and Warminster. Corsley comprises a scattering of rural hamlets, situated around historic Cley Hill with the Longleat Estate nearby. The village is set near to the Somerset and Wiltshire border, and is within commuting distance of Bath, Bristol and Salisbury. There is a main line connection to London (Paddington) from Westbury station. Private Schools are to be found in Warminster and Bath.
